#d04796 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d04796 is composed of 81.6% red, 27.8%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.9% magenta, 27.9%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 325.4 degrees, a saturation of 59.3% and a lightness of 54.7%. #d04796 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8eff with #a1002d.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#d04796 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d04796 has RGB values of R:208, G:71,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.66, Y:0.28,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13649814.
